Привязать htop к одному конкретному процессу?

Привязать htop к одному конкретному процессу?

У меня есть длинный список процессов, отображаемых в htop, но меня интересует только один из них. Поскольку старые процессы завершаются и создаются новые, htopотображаемый список процессов постоянно обновляется, что означает, что один интересующий меня процесс постоянно прыгает вверх и вниз по списку.

Можно ли как-то отключить это поведение?

То есть, я хотел бы привязать прокрутку к этому конкретному процессу. Как это сделать?

решение1

Вы не можете прикрепить заданную строку процесса к началу, но htopможете следить за процессом, если нажмете Shift+ F. Изстраница руководства:

   F    "Follow" process: if the sort order causes the currently  selected
        process  to  move  in  the list, make the selection bar follow it.
        This is useful for monitoring a process: this way, you can keep  a
        process  always  visible  on  screen. When a movement key is used,
        "follow" loses effect.

Вот мой процесс в Firefox:

введите описание изображения здесь

Обратите внимание, что если вас интересует только один конкретный процесс, то он -p <pid>сделает то, что вам нужно (12352 — это pid Firefox в моей системе):

$ htop -p 12352

введите описание изображения здесь

решение2

Вы можете сделать фильтр, используя F3и ввести часть команды в поле ввода для фильтра. Это, по крайней мере, сузит ваш список процессов, чтобы другие несвязанные команды не отодвинули те, которые вам интересны, вниз или вверх по странице.

Связанный контент